IT Losing Confidence of the Business: Operations Leaders Weigh in on Impacts of Under-Resourced IT

TrackVia surveyed over 200 enterprise operation executives in March of 2019 to discover what’s standing in the way of digital transformation, and IT remains high on their list, citing limited resources, staff, and outdated technology.

